Trade in your iphone and get up to $350 off on the new T-Mobile HTC HD2
If you find yourself with an iPhone that you want to get rid of, T-Mobile is hoping you may want to hand it off to them in exchange for up to $350 in credit towards the purchase of the new HTC HD2. Participating T-Mobile locations will be able to give you $100-350 in credit toward the HD2, even if you are simply looking the purchase the handset outright. The discount falls under their smartphone train-in/recycle program with HTC. All you need is an iPhone that is functional (no broken or leaking screen and no water damage or corrosion).
